Vigil Mass
Reading I: Genesis 11:1-9 or Exodus 19:3-8a, 16-20b
or Ezekiel 37:1-14 or Joel 3:1-5
Responsorial Psalm 104:1-2, 24, 35, 27-28, 29, 30
Reading II: Romans 8:22-27
Gospel: John 7:37-39

Mass During the Day
Reading I: Acts 2:1-11
Responsorial Psalm 104:1, 24, 29-30, 31, 34
Reading II: 1 Corinthians 12:3b-7, 12-13 or Romans 8:8-17
Gospel: John 20:19-23 or John 14:15-16, 23b-26
